Taiwan Ingredients

Pork Wrapper Dumplings

小麦粉ゼロ!豚肉を限界まで叩いて作った「肉の皮」で餡を包む狂気の餃子

Pescatarian (Not possible as it contains pork)

Description

A hot pot dumpling where the skin isn't wheat flour, but 'Yan Pi (Meat Wrapper)' made by pounding pork and kneading it with sweet potato flour. A premium ingredient featuring intense elasticity and umami.

How to use

Ingredients

  • Lean pork and sweet potato flour(for skin)
  • Minced pork
  • Shallots
  • Sesame oil

Instructions

  1. [Prep/Usage]
  2. [Hot Pot] Sold frozen as 'Huo Guo Liao (Hot Pot Ingredients)' in Taiwanese supers. Toss unthawed directly into boiling hot pot soup (Mala or Shacha).
  3. [Texture Secret] Yan Pi combines pork protein and starch, so it absolutely never breaks when boiled. Ready when boiled a few mins and the skin turns translucent and floats.
  4. [Soup Ingredient] Dropping it like a wonton into a light pork broth with celery and scallions (Rou Yan Tang) is also a massive staple in Taiwanese eateries.

Trivia

[Hardcore] A crazy method devised by Fujian chefs to 'wrap meat in meat'. One of Taiwan hot pot's Big Three dumplings alongside 'Yu Jiao (fish skin)' and 'Dan Jiao (egg skin)' sold in supers, but the most premium due to laborious production. The 'push-back elasticity' on a different dimension from wheat skins is addictive once eaten.
